当前位置:首页 > 开发教程 > 正文内容

十六进制颜色码转图片,十六进制颜色码图片转换工具

wzgly3个月前 (06-05)开发教程2
介绍了十六进制颜色码转换为图片的方法,通过解析十六进制颜色值,可以生成相应的图片文件,过程涉及将颜色代码转换为像素数据,并利用图像处理库将数据绘制成图像,从而实现颜色码到图片的转换。

十六进制颜色码转图片——轻松掌握图片色彩的魔法

用户解答: 大家好,我最近在学习网页设计,但遇到了一个小问题,我在网上看到了一些漂亮的图片,颜色搭配得非常和谐,我就想自己尝试制作类似的图片,我发现这些图片的颜色是用十六进制颜色码表示的,我不知道如何将这些颜色码转换成实际的图片,有人能帮帮我吗?

下面,我将从几个出发,地为大家讲解如何将十六进制颜色码转换成图片。

十六进制颜色码转图片

一:什么是十六进制颜色码?

  1. 定义:十六进制颜色码是一种用六位十六进制数字表示的颜色编码方式,通常以开头,后面跟着六位数字或字母。
  2. 组成:每两位数字或字母代表一种颜色分量,即红色(R)、绿色(G)、蓝色(B)。
  3. 格式#FFFFFF表示白色,#FF0000表示红色。

二:如何获取十六进制颜色码?

  1. 在线工具:可以使用各种在线工具将图片的颜色转换为十六进制颜色码。
  2. 图片编辑软件:在图片编辑软件中,选中图片中的颜色,通常可以查看到其十六进制颜色码。
  3. 网页颜色选择器:许多网页设计软件都内置了颜色选择器,可以直接选择颜色并获取其十六进制代码。

三:十六进制颜色码转图片的步骤

  1. 选择图片编辑软件:选择一款支持导入十六进制颜色码的图片编辑软件,如Photoshop、GIMP等。
  2. 创建新文件:根据需要创建一个新的图片文件,设置其分辨率和颜色模式。
  3. 填充颜色:将十六进制颜色码输入到软件的调色板或颜色选择器中,将选中的颜色填充到图片中。
  4. 保存图片:完成颜色填充后,保存图片文件。

四:常见问题及解决方案

  1. 问题:十六进制颜色码与RGB颜色值不一致。 解决方案:确保输入的颜色码正确无误,或者检查软件的调色板设置是否正确。
  2. 问题:转换后的图片颜色不鲜艳。 解决方案:尝试调整图片的亮度、对比度等参数,以改善颜色效果。
  3. 问题:图片编辑软件不支持十六进制颜色码。 解决方案:尝试使用其他支持该功能的软件,或者查找软件的更新版本。

五:十六进制颜色码在网页设计中的应用

  1. 一致性:使用统一的十六进制颜色码可以确保网页上所有元素的色彩一致性。
  2. 可定制性:十六进制颜色码允许设计者精确控制网页元素的色彩。
  3. 兼容性:大多数浏览器都支持十六进制颜色码,使得网页在不同设备上显示效果一致。

通过以上讲解,相信大家对如何将十六进制颜色码转换成图片有了更深入的了解,不妨动手尝试一下,将你喜欢的颜色应用到自己的图片设计中吧!

其他相关扩展阅读资料参考文献:

十六进制颜色码如何生成图片

基本概念与原理

  1. 十六进制颜色码的结构
    十六进制颜色码由#RRGGBB组成,其中RR、GG、BB分别代表红色、绿色、蓝色的十六进制值(00-FF),每个字符对应8位二进制数,共24位可定义1677万种颜色,这是数字图像处理中最基础的颜色表示方式
  2. 与RGB的转换关系
    十六进制颜色码与RGB三元组可相互转换。#FF0000对应RGB(255,0,0),两者本质是同一颜色数据的不同编码形式,转换时需注意数值范围的对应关系。
  3. 常见颜色码示例
    转换方法与操作步骤
  4. 手动转换的逻辑
    将十六进制值拆分为三部分,分别转换为十进制。#AABBCC拆分为AA(红色)、BB(绿色)、CC(蓝色),每部分需用计算器或编程工具进行十六进制到十进制的换算
  5. 在线工具的高效性
    使用如“Color Converter”或“RGB to HEX”等网站,输入颜色码后可一键生成图片。这些工具通常支持批量处理和格式导出(如PNG、JPEG),适合快速验证颜色效果。
  6. 编程实现的灵活性
    通过Python的PIL库或JavaScript的Canvas API,可编写脚本将颜色码生成图片,Python代码:Image.new("RGB", (100, 100), color="#FF5733")代码实现需注意图像尺寸和背景设置
  7. 图像编辑软件的嵌入功能
    Photoshop、GIMP等工具支持直接输入十六进制颜色码创建色块。操作时需在颜色面板中切换为“十六进制”模式,并确认颜色预览的准确性

实际应用场景分析

十六进制颜色码转图片
  1. 网页设计中的色块生成
    设计师常通过颜色码快速生成测试色块,确保网页配色与品牌VI一致。将#007BFF用于按钮背景,可直接复制到CSS代码中
  2. 图像处理中的颜色调整
    在调整图片颜色时,颜色码可作为精确参考。如将图片的主色调从#FF0000改为#FFA500,需通过软件的调色工具逐步逼近目标值
  3. 品牌设计中的统一规范
    企业LOGO和宣传材料需使用固定颜色码,如#008CBA作为品牌主色,可避免不同设备或软件导致的颜色偏差
  4. 数据可视化中的颜色映射
    在图表设计中,颜色码用于区分数据类别。使用#FF6B6B表示高温区域,需确保颜色在不同分辨率下清晰可辨
  5. UI设计中的动态调色
    开发者通过颜色码实现UI组件的动态配色,如根据用户主题切换背景色,需将颜色码嵌入到代码逻辑中

工具选择与效率提升

  1. 在线转换器的便捷性
    推荐使用“https://htmlcolorcodes.com/”等工具,输入颜色码后可生成图片并复制代码。这类工具适合临时需求,但无法保存历史记录
  2. 专业软件的深度功能
    Photoshop的“颜色面板”支持十六进制输入,并可导出为多种格式。其优势在于精确的颜色管理和图层操作功能
  3. 编程库的自动化优势
    Python的Pillow库或JavaScript的Fabric.js可批量生成颜色图片,适合需要大量重复操作的场景
  4. 代码生成工具的扩展性
    如使用“https://colorhexa.com/”网站生成颜色代码,可直接导出为SVG或PNG文件。这些工具常与设计软件集成,提升协作效率
  5. 跨平台兼容性的注意事项
    不同操作系统对颜色码的显示可能存在差异,需在目标设备上测试生成图片的视觉效果

常见问题与解决方案

  1. 颜色显示不一致的排查
    若生成图片颜色与预期不符,可能是显示器色域或软件色彩配置问题。建议使用标准色卡或校准显示器以确保准确性
  2. 透明度处理的特殊性
    十六进制颜色码默认不包含Alpha通道,若需生成半透明图片,需额外添加#RRGGBBAA格式并调整透明度参数
  3. 批量转换的优化技巧
    处理大量颜色码时,可使用脚本或工具批量生成图片,避免手动重复操作导致的效率低下
  4. 格式兼容性的验证方法
    生成的图片需测试在不同平台(如网页、移动应用)中的显示效果,部分格式可能因压缩导致颜色失真
  5. 版本控制的必要性
    在团队协作中,颜色码需记录版本信息,避免因颜色调整导致设计文件混乱


十六进制颜色码转图片的核心在于理解其编码逻辑与应用场景。无论是手动转换、编程实现还是工具辅助,关键都是确保颜色的精确性与一致性,随着设计需求的多样化,掌握这一技能可显著提升工作效率,同时为跨平台开发提供可靠支持。随着AI设计工具的发展,颜色码的自动化应用将进一步简化这一过程

十六进制颜色码转图片

扫描二维码推送至手机访问。

版权声明:本文由码界编程网发布,如需转载请注明出处。

本文链接:http://b2b.dropc.cn/kfjc/2480.html

分享给朋友:

“十六进制颜色码转图片,十六进制颜色码图片转换工具” 的相关文章

asp服务器软件,ASP服务器软件,构建动态网页的强大工具

asp服务器软件,ASP服务器软件,构建动态网页的强大工具

ASP服务器软件,全称Active Server Pages,是一种服务器端脚本环境,由微软开发,它允许开发者在HTML页面中嵌入VBScript或JScript代码,实现动态网页制作,通过ASP,开发者可以创建包含数据库查询、表单处理、用户身份验证等功能的应用程序,该软件与IIS(Internet...

html网页生成工具,一键生成HTML网页的实用工具

html网页生成工具,一键生成HTML网页的实用工具

HTML网页生成工具是一款用于创建和编辑HTML网页的软件或在线平台,它提供直观的用户界面,允许用户通过拖放元素、编辑代码或使用模板来快速构建网页,这些工具通常具备丰富的功能和扩展,支持响应式设计,以便网页在不同设备和屏幕尺寸上都能良好显示,用户无需深入了解HTML和CSS代码,即可轻松生成专业级别...

计算机源码网站,计算机源码资源库大全

计算机源码网站,计算机源码资源库大全

计算机源码网站是一个提供计算机源代码资源的平台,汇集了各类编程语言的源码,包括但不限于C、C++、Java、Python等,用户可以在这里搜索、下载、分享和讨论各种开源项目,为编程爱好者、开发者提供便捷的代码获取途径和技术交流空间。丰富的源码资源 这个网站拥有海量的计算机源码,涵盖了从入门级到高级...

c+音乐播放器代码,C++音乐播放器实现代码

c+音乐播放器代码,C++音乐播放器实现代码

本代码是一个C语言编写的音乐播放器,具备基本的播放、暂停、停止和曲目切换功能,用户可通过控制台输入指令来操作播放器,代码结构清晰,易于理解和修改,适用于学习C语言和音乐播放器开发。C++音乐播放器代码:从入门到实践 用户解答: 嗨,大家好!我是一名编程新手,最近对C++产生了浓厚的兴趣,我想尝试...

html超链接标签是什么,HTML超链接标签解析指南

html超链接标签是什么,HTML超链接标签解析指南

HTML超链接标签是用于创建网页中链接的标记,它允许用户从一个页面跳转到另一个页面,该标签通常包含`标签,并通过href属性指定链接的目标URL,用户点击超链接时,可以访问到href属性指定的网页或资源,超链接可以指向同一网站内的页面、其他网站、电子邮件地址或特定网页内的锚点位置,超链接还可以通过t...

编程的代码有哪些,编程语言与代码种类的介绍

编程的代码有哪些,编程语言与代码种类的介绍

编程代码种类繁多,包括但不限于以下几种:,1. 高级编程语言代码:如Python、Java、C++、JavaScript等,这些语言提供丰富的库和框架,易于理解和编写复杂程序。,2. 低级编程语言代码:如汇编语言,直接与硬件交互,执行效率高,但可读性较差。,3. 标准库代码:如C标准库、Python...